Kathmandu, Nepal, April 22, 2014: Vinod Kumar of Delhi steered his team to victory at the Pro-Am event of the Surya Nepal Masters 2014 at the Gokarna Forest Golf Resort. A record number of amateurs from across Nepal participated in the event.

The popularity of the Surya Nepal Masters Pro-Am is growing by the year as it provides the amateurs with the golden opportunity of playing with prominent professionals in the SAARC golf space.

The event featured 34 teams, each comprising of one professional and three amateurs. The format of the event this year was stroke-play, where the best two nett scores per hole were counted for the team score.

Professional Abhijit Singh Chadha’s team finished in the second runner-up position with a score of 122. Chadha’s team comprised of amateurs A.T. Sherpa, President of Gokarna Forest Golf Resort Suhrid Ghimire and Pavitra Karki. Chadha was the runner-up at the 2013 Surya Nepal Masters.

At one stroke better was the runner-up team lead by professional Gaurav Pratap Singh. Singh’s team included one of Nepal’s leading amateurs Tashi Tshering. The other two amateurs in Gaurav’s team were Kanchan Basnyat and MD Mool.

The champion team at 120 was lead by Delhi professional Vinod Kumar and had Tendi Sherpa and Dorjee Sherpa along with the President of Nepal Professional Golf Association Rabindra Man Shrestha as the three amateurs.

The on-course prizes for Closest to the Pin on Hole No. 5 was won by Mr. Bishnu Sharma, Closest to the Pin on Hole No. 10 by Mr. Raj Pradhan and the Straightest Drive on Hole No. 18 by Mr. Roshan Rai.

The prizes were given away by Mr. Dipra Lahiri, Vice President-Marketing, Surya Nepal Pvt. Ltd.
